The Appeal of Artificial Plants in Modern Decor
Modern fake plants for interiors are crafted using high-quality materials like premium silk, polyethylene, or PU, resulting in a natural texture and true-to-life colour. These plants imitate real leaves and stems with fine detailing, making them nearly indistinguishable from living ones. Beyond aesthetics, they offer the benefit of being allergy-free and long-lasting, maintaining their lush look for years.

Benefits of Artificial Plants Compared to Real Plants
One of the most important advantages of artificial plants is their low upkeep. Unlike real plants, they do not require watering, fertilising, or specific lighting. This makes them perfect for people who travel frequently, or live in areas with low-light conditions. They remain beautiful and vivid throughout the year, unaffected by seasonal changes.
In addition, artificial plants are budget-friendly in the long term. Once purchased, they need only minimal cleaning to keep them looking fresh. They also eliminate the risk of pests, mud stains, and mould issues, ensuring a healthier living environment.
Another key advantage is their versatility in design. Since they are easy to move and long-lasting, they can be easily repositioned or transported to refresh the decor whenever desired. This flexibility makes them perfect for homes, offices, restaurants, hospitality spaces, and showrooms.
